Payson staff say existing event‑center water lines restrict fire flows; booster-station upgrade and arena cover would cost hundreds of thousands to millions

Summary

Town staff told the council that on-site service lines at the Payson Event Center are undersized and limit flow despite a large mains supply; engineering estimates put a new 3,000‑gpm booster station at about $900,000–$1.1 million, while fully enclosing the arena could cost millions and a grandstand cover may be a lower‑cost interim option.

Town staff told the council on June 10 that the town’s water main along Green Valley Parkway has adequate fire flow, but the event‑center’s on‑site service lines and a small booster station limit usable flow for the rodeo grounds and a larger enclosed event center.

“Tthe water main in the road is sufficient,” said Tanner (public works staff), but, he added, on‑site service lines had been run piecemeal over time and many are only three‑quarter‑inch pipe. He said that at roughly 40 psi a 400‑foot 3/4‑inch PVC line will deliver only about 8 gallons a minute, “takes a long time to fill up a horse trough at 8 gallons a minute.” Tanner told the council the town’s roadway hydrant currently flows about 1,730 gallons a minute at the tanks, but that the booster station located on the event‑center site is dedicated to the Tohono Apache tribe and can only supply about 100 gallons per minute; an off‑site connection at Phoenix Street supplies up to 1,000 gpm, for a combined contractual capacity of about 1,100 gpm.

Tanner said the technical fix for event‑center shortfalls is to upsize on‑site service piping and, if needed for larger buildings or higher fire‑flow requirements, build a larger booster station and new pressurized mains. He outlined a conceptual 3,000‑gpm booster configuration with five pumps, a 5,000‑gallon hydro pneumatic tank and generator and said, based on recent local private projects, the town could expect a ballpark cost of about $900,000–$1.1 million.

Kyle (parks and recreation staff) spoke next about options for covering the arena. He said a pre‑engineered metal building to fully enclose the arena could have a steel cost alone in the low‑to‑mid millions and erection, engineering and site work would add significantly. As a lower‑cost alternative, Kyle described covering only the grandstands: he estimated roughly $450,000 in steel for the cover and a total project cost “potentially like about $1,500,000 to $2,000,000” including erection and related work. He also noted trade‑offs: a full cover reduces the need for sprinklers but creates costs for lighting, climate control and, if closed, fire‑protection systems.

Council members pressed staff about whether the town should size water infrastructure to meet future tribal development or only the town’s event‑center needs. Tanner said the town’s existing intergovernmental agreement obliges the town to supply up to 100 gpm from the event‑center booster and 1,000 gpm from the Phoenix Street connection to the Tohono Apache tribal supply point, but the town could negotiate a separate agreement if the town were to build new infrastructure sized to serve both parties. "Our current agreement with them does obligate them to pay back fees," Tanner said.

The manager noted the council has already set aside $1,000,000 toward the event center in the current budget, and staff said the next steps would include refined engineering, drainage and infrastructure assessments and possibly contracting Kimley‑Horn or similar consultants to complete a master plan and firm cost estimates.

Next steps: staff will continue engineering evaluations and prepare costed options for the council; council members directed staff to return with more‑detailed budgets and implementation plans before any construction authorization.
